Research direction
Start with GithubClient.java at lines 103 and 64, where the Azure MCP release lookup and retry flow are shown in the stack trace. Inspect how the GitHub response is deserialized into GithubRelease objects; done means Azure MCP initialization completes without the uncaught exception.
